The mechanisms of hot deformation have been determined to be dynamic: recovery and dynamic recrystallization which control the flow stress developed and the rate of crack propagation. Through their subsequent interaction with static recovery and static recrystallization, which occur whenever the metal remains hot after deformation, they also dete-rmine the structure and properties either upon cooling or at entrance to another stage of deformation.
